    Heroes’ Mile is a veteran-led treatment center where clients are supported by peers who understand military life firsthand. Located in Deland, Florida, the facility offers trauma-informed care and psychiatric services through distinct tracks for both veterans and civilians, providing a rare, culturally competent environment for recovery.

    Easily accessible by major roads and public transportation, Daytona Treatment Center is part of New Season, a nationwide treatment network providing comprehensive outpatient care designed to support opioid recovery. The center’s flexible programs allow clients to continue their daily activities while receiving care. Services include medications for addiction treatment (MAT), with options such as methadone, buprenorphine and Suboxone, to address withdrawal and cravings. Licensed counseling services are integrated into care plans and clients who reach certain milestones in their recovery can receive take-home medications. No appointment is required to receive services.

    Metro Treatment of Florida LP - New Season Treatment Center 4 helps people recover from opioid addiction by combining medication-assisted treatment (MAT) with counseling. Conveniently located, the center supports individuals at every stage of their recovery. They use FDA-approved medications like methadone, buprenorphine, and Suboxone, based on each person's needs. The medical staff and counselors work together to create personalized treatment plans. They also provide educational resources and support groups for patients and their families to better understand addiction and recovery.
